- Tuition reimbursement A Brief Overview This position is responsible for providing support to the quality and regulatory activities within Pathology - this position will support our anatomic pathology and cytopathology departments.
Areas of focuses for the Quality Department are driving overall process improvement, workflow mapping and development, conduct safety reviews, coordinate response efforts to nonconformances, development of educational content and tools to improve quality outcomes, and ensure compliance with regulatory and accreditation entities. This role manages ad hoc projects that fall into these categories for the system, as well as long-term initiatives, with the overarching goal of creating standardization to ensure the same, high quality experience for all patients interacting with UH Pathology. What You Will Do Lead internal and external regulatory surveys and inspections, and standardize response process across the system. Responsible for achieving and maintaining compliance with regulatory and accrediting agencies (e.g. CAP, CLIA, ODH, DNV, FDA, ASHI, etc.) for all laboratory sections and locations across all patient settings. Orders, monitors and coordinates proficiency testing survey program and ensures compliance with Clinical Laboratory Improvement Amendments (CLIA). Develop Media Lab content in Compass and Document Control modules to align with strategic goals and regulatory standards, with the goal of achieving standardization policy and procedure organization across the system. Serve as representative on a variety of Quality related committees to create system alignment in Quality and Regulatory affairs for the system, as well as disseminate recall and safety notices throughout the system. Manage and develop system-wide database containing quality metrics for various laboratory sections. Pull data for quality indicator review for the various sections within pathology for review at Quality Management meetings, and facilitate Quality Management meetings. Coordinate development and implementation of action plans when metrics fall below acceptable threshold. Participate in Learning From Defects reviews and project manage action items coming out of the meeting to close the loop on patient safety issues, as well as disseminate solutions and best practices to the system.
